Job Duties
- Serve as the district’s primary contract administrator for outsourced transportation and food service providers
- monitor vendor compliance with contract terms, service level agreements, ISBE transportation requirements, USDA nutrition standards, and district expectations
- conduct regular performance reviews with vendors
- address service issues, corrective actions, and compliance concerns
- coordinate contract renewals, amendments, and rebids in collaboration with purchasing, finance, and legal counsel
- review and approve vendor invoices, ridership data, routing reports, and service documentation for accuracy and compliance
- maintain strong working knowledge of ISBE transportation rules, student eligibility, safety requirements, and reporting expectations
- serve as the district’s transportation subject-matter resource
- consult with vendors to coordinate transportation logistics including routing changes, service disruptions, and emergency response
- review and analyze routing efficiency, on-time performance, ride times, and service equity
- ensure accurate transportation records and documentation for audits
- oversee contracted food service operations ensuring compliance with federal and state nutrition requirements
- coordinate meal service schedules and program accessibility with vendors and administrators
- monitor food service quality, participation trends, and compliance documentation
- ensure school food authority responsibilities are met
- serve as a primary point of contact for parents and guardians regarding transportation and food service concerns
- build and maintain positive relationships with parents, administrators, community members, and service providers
- address concerns professionally and empathetically
- analyze service costs, contract metrics, and operational data to ensure fiscal responsibility
- support budget development and long-term planning
- identify cost-saving opportunities while maintaining safety and quality
- prepare reports and recommendations for district leadership and board of education
- develop and recommend administrative procedures related to support operations
- monitor regulatory and industry changes and recommend updates
- support long-term planning and continuous improvement
- promote a culture of accountability and customer service
- manage and lead the district’s transportation and food service support staff
